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Nonno Mio.
- Make a reservation during weekends as it gets busy.
- Try their Galeto ao Primo Canto for an authentic local flavor.
- Pair your meal with a wine from their extensive list for the best experience.
- Visit during weekdays for shorter wait times.
- Don't forget to save room for dessert; their Tiramisu is highly recommended.
